I take it you have all the tappets backed off fully and the rocker arms held up out of the way with rubber bands and if possible, someone pushing the cover down flat when you're trying to do the bolts up to reduce the pressure?. It's very rare to pull helicoils out unless there is an awful lot of pressure being exerted on them. If the helicoils had have been loose, why didn't they come out when you stripped the top end down 🤔🤔🤔It's very, very easy to bend valves and crack the valve guides without taking the pressure off by doing the above.
If they have unscrewed you can replace them, if they have pulled out its a problem.Are they short coils in deep holes? If so an answer is possible but complicated, i dont think there is metal for timeserts(they need a 10mm outer thread)
